how to get 1000 points for achievement


You need activity points, which you get for making posts in the forum, sending messages and blog posts.
The points you have used to be shown on your profile but they have dropped them several years ago. I believe that they are still being tracked somewhere, so you can eventually still get the award.
https://www.chess.com/forum/view/site-feedback/inquiry-regarding-awards